1) Be stubbornly YOU
This year, without realizing, I tried morphing myself into someone I am not. Next year, this is not happening.
Don’t follow trends, creators, influencers and idols so blindly you forget to be yourself.
Harsh truth, you can never be as successful as they are, no matter how hard you try.
No, not because they are better than you. But because they are THE BEST at being themselves.
Just like you are the BEST at being yourself.
Find your strengths and utilize them.
Accept your weaknesses, they are part of your charm.
Be unapologetically YOU-nique.
2) Ditch the people-pleaser act
Major league mistake I made when I joined X 3 months ago.
I tried to get close with some bigger creators who made my gut retch. Eventually gave up the act and guess what?
I met the people who make me excited to check my DMs every morning, who support me through the highs and lows.
Don’t force yourself to be in a group that makes you feel uncomfortable.
“But then I won’t have any friends!”
Then be friendless. Better to be alone than feeling like an outcast.
And trust me, given enough time, the right people would come and find you.
If a religious introvert like me could find her community, they so can you.
3) Be 0.1% better everyday
That’s 36.5% better than the year before. If you can keep it up.
With just a tiny meeny miniscule effort to be better than yesterday, you can end up so much closer to level of the people you admire.
Let’s just take posts for example. If you strive to be better every time you write a post, what power on earth can stop you from achieving all of your dreams?
Exactly, NONE.
This is the one goal I will try my hardest to achieve. You do too.
Tiny droplets of hard work eventually pools to become an ocean after all.
